Arizona Behavioral Counseling and Education, Inc. is an addiction treatment center in Phoenix, AZ that provides outpatient care for alcoholism, substance abuse, and drug addiction with private health insurance accepted.
About This Phoenix, AZ Facility
Arizona Behavioral Counseling and Education, Inc., located in Phoenix, Arizona, is an addiction treatment facility offering comprehensive services to individuals struggling with substance abuse and addiction. They provide a full spectrum of care with services that range from intervention services to residential and outpatient programs. Their experienced team of specialists offer treatment that is tailored to the individual’s unique needs and situation. In addition to offering evidence-based addiction treatment, they provide extensive family services, specialized therapy, and support for co-occurring mood disorder. They are also licensed by the state of Arizona as an addiction treatment provider and have received accreditation from the Joint Commission as a specialty provider of behavioral health services.
Arizona Behavioral Counseling and Education, Inc. offers a comprehensive range of treatment services for those with substance abuse issues. They provide both individual and group therapy to help individuals understand and manage their emotions, teach coping skills and relapse prevention, and create a strong foundation for a successful recovery. Their team of experienced professionals also help individuals build life skills that are essential for sustaining long-term sobriety, such as stress management, communication skills, conflict resolution, and problem-solving. In addition, Arizona Behavioral Counseling and Education, Inc. provides treatment for co-occurring disorders to address any underlying mental health issues that may be exacerbating the addiction.

In group therapy, the patient undergoes sessions with other patients dealing with similar problems under the guidance of a trained counselor. The members of the group interact with each other and talk freely about their issues. The recovery of members of the group from the problems that they face gives the patients confidence that they can also overcome their addiction.
Group therapy at Arizona Behavioral Counseling and Education, Inc. reduces the feeling of loneliness and improves the coping skills of the patients. Group therapy provides patients with continuous feedback from other members. The group dynamics ensure that members start having some structure and routine in their lives.
Cognitive behavioral therapy (CBT) is a way of addressing concerns through talking. Talking through issues can identify sources of discomfort or unhealthy thoughts. CBT is a healthy way Arizona Behavioral Counseling and Education, Inc. addresses some behaviors which may be bringing unintended consequences in a persons life.
The 12 step program is the treatment method used by Alcoholics Anonymous, but it can apply to any type of addiction. It outlines the 12 steps addicts should take on the path to recovery. Steps include admitting you have a problem and making the decision to turn your life around. A belief in a higher power and making amends to others are also part of the program.

Phoenix, Arizona Addiction Information
Arizona has some of the highest rates of prescription drug abuse in the United States. Methamphetamines, heroin and morphine are among the most commonly abused substances. Prescription pain relievers were prescribed to 348 million people in 2012, enough to medicate every adult in Arizona for 2 full weeks. The number of people with substance use disorders in Arizona has remained relatively constant over the past few years.
In 2012, over 246,000 people were living in Phoenix dependent on or abusing drugs. This amounted to 10.8% of the city's population. In 2016, over 1,000 emergency room visits related to heroin and over 2,500 for cocaine. These numbers are only going up. There are many different rehabilitation facilities in the city and some 12-step meetings and support groups available for help.
